Hard New Route in Alaska's Hayes Range
posted: July 03, 2009
7/03/09 - Samuel Johnson and Matt Klick made the first ascent of the northern ridge on 11,140-foot Mt. Balchen in Alaska’s Hayes Range in a lightweight two-day climb.
